About H. Kawamoto
H. Kawamoto is a scholar working on Materials Chemistry, Computational Mechanics and Biomedical Engineering, having authored 9 papers that have together received 355 indexed citations. Recurring topics across this work include Graphene research and applications (6 papers), Carbon Nanotubes in Composites (6 papers) and Ion-surface interactions and analysis (3 papers). The work is most often cited by research in Materials Chemistry (297 citations), Electronic, Optical and Magnetic Materials (53 citations) and Electrochemistry (13 citations). H. Kawamoto has collaborated with scholars based in Japan. Frequent co-authors include Kenichi Kojima, Masaru Tachibana, Takashi Uchida, Akihiko Yoshimura, H. Nakai, H. Koizumi, Makoto Tanimura, Keita Kobayashi, Hirofumi Yoshimura and Ken-ichi KOBAYASHI. Their work appears in journals such as Journal of Applied Physics, Chemical Physics Letters and Journal of Physics D Applied Physics.
